mulligan

[US]/'mʌlɪg(ə)n/
[UK]/'mʌlɪgən/
Frequency: Very High

Translation

n.a dish made with vegetables and meat (or fish), an Irish person;;(Golf) an extra stroke allowed after a poor shot, especially in informal play.
Word Forms
Pluralmulligans

Phrases & Collocations

take a mulligan
